Mobs: The Main Attraction
Shulkers are the only mobs that can be found within the End City. These creatures are notoriously elusive and only spawn within the city itself or on the End Ship. Disguised as purpur blocks, they have the ability to lift their shells and attack unsuspecting adventurers.
